I had the K701's for a short time and decided to part with them for monetary reasons. I am thinking of getting another pair and re-cabling them. For this reason I am thinking of getting the K702 this time which makes it easy to get another cable later. My question is does a re-cable on these headphones really help if it enters through only one side and the inner wiring is not changed? Dual entry seems to make more sense but would like to hear if anyone has heard the difference and if it is worth concern.
